Ron asked: 

>I see some Meteorites for sale, especially the 
>Willamette Meteorite, listed as Meteorite Shale.
>What exactly is Meteorite Shale?

It is a term used for a highly weathered (terrestrialized) meteorite.
The use of “shale”, I suspect, came from the tendency of some
highly weathered meteorites, specifically highly oxidized iron
meteorites to develope a layered structure as they weather and 
break into subparallel / parallel layers like shale when broken.

The terms “shale balls” and “iron shale” is also used for 
some highly weathered meteorites.
